Blue Jays activate Shane Bieber, designate Hayden Juenger for assignment

Shane Bieber is officially back.
After being announced as the Tuesday starter against the Houston Astros, the Toronto Blue Jays have officially activated Shane Bieber from the IL. On the active roster, Lazaro Estrada has been optioned back to Triple-A, and for the 40-man roster, the Jays have designated right-hander Hayden Juenger for assignment.
Bieber will be making his first start of the season after landing on the IL during Spring Training. The right-hander has been throwing in rehab games since May 25th and has been slowly upping his pitch count with each start. He last pitched against the Charlotte Knights on June 17th, where he went five innings and allowed seven hits, five earned runs and two home runs while also walking four compared to two strikeouts.
The right-hander rejoined the Jays this past winter after exercising his player option worth $16 million, foregoing free agency in favour of returning to Toronto. The Jays acquired Bieber from the Cleveland Guardians at the 2025 trade deadline in exchange for prospect Khal Stephen. Bieber would make seven starts for the Jays down the stretch, posting a 3.57 ERA and a 4.47 FIP. He also appeared in five games for Toronto during their World Series run.
To make room for Bieber on the 40-man roster, the Jays designated Hayden Juenger for assignment.
Juenger, a 6th-round pick of the organization back in 2021, has toiled in Triple-A Buffalo since 2022 and made his big league debut earlier this season. The right-hander appeared in two games for the Jays, allowing two hits, two walks, and three earned runs through two innings of work. This season in Triple-A, Juenger has pitched to a 2.59 ERA across 24.1 innings.
For the active roster, the Jays are sending right-hander Lazaro Estrada back to the Bisons.
The Cuban product was recently activated off the IL, and last appeared on June 20th against the Chicago White Sox, where he allowed one hit, two walks, and two earned runs through 2.1 innings of work.
